TypechoJoeTheme

至尊技术网

统计
登录
用户名
密码
/
注册
用户名
邮箱

微信拦截域名解决方案:优化用户体验与安全策略的平衡

2025-02-09
/
0 评论
/
47 阅读
/
正在检测是否收录...
02/09

一、理解微信的域名拦截机制

微信对外部链接的拦截主要基于两个方面:一是安全考虑,防止恶意链接或欺诈行为;二是用户体验,避免用户在不安全的环境下访问非官方认证的网站。这一机制通过域名白名单和严格的审核流程来实施。

二、设置域名白名单

  1. 注册与认证:首先,确保你的网站已通过微信公众平台或小程序平台的注册和认证流程。这包括完成主体信息的验证、选择服务类目并提交相关资质文件。

  2. 申请白名单:登录微信公众平台或小程序后台,在“设置”或“开发”菜单下找到“请求白名单”或“安全设置”的选项,按要求填写相关信息(如域名、用途说明等),并提交审核。审核通过后,该域名将被加入白名单,用户可以在微信内直接访问。

  3. 测试与验证:在域名被添加到白名单后,建议进行实际访问测试以验证是否可以正常访问。同时,关注任何可能出现的通知或警告,确保所有配置正确无误。

三、使用微信JS-SDK增强安全性与功能

  1. 集成JS-SDK:在符合白名单条件的网页中引入微信JS-SDK,可以增加如分享、支付、登录等功能的便捷性和安全性。通过SDK提供的API,可以更好地控制页面在微信环境中的表现和行为。

  2. 安全策略:利用JS-SDK的权限验证和签名机制,确保只有合法的页面才能调用特定功能,这可以有效防止跨站脚本攻击(XSS)等安全威胁。开发者需按照官方文档正确实现这些安全措施。

  3. 调试工具:使用微信开发者工具进行本地调试和预览,该工具提供了丰富的调试功能,帮助开发者快速定位和解决在微信环境中遇到的问题。

四、考虑第三方服务集成策略

对于非必需加入白名单的外部服务(如统计分析、外部API调用等),推荐使用官方推荐的第三方服务解决方案,如微信公众号/小程序数据分析工具等。这些服务通常已经与微信平台达成合作协议,可以在不违反平台规则的前提下使用。若必须使用自定义第三方服务,需确保该服务也遵循了相应的安全标准和隐私政策。

五、合规与法律注意事项

在实施上述策略时,务必遵守《中华人民共和国网络安全法》、微信平台的相关政策及用户隐私保护法律法规。确保在收集、处理和传输用户数据时符合相关规定,避免法律风险。

六、持续监控与更新

随着技术发展和平台政策的变化,定期检查和更新你的域名白名单设置和使用的技术方案是必要的。保持对最新政策和最佳实践的关注,可以确保你的解决方案始终符合当前的安全标准和用户体验要求。

结论

通过上述方法,开发者可以在确保遵守微信平台规则的同时,有效解决微信拦截域名的挑战。这不仅能够提升用户体验,还能增强网站或应用的安全性。记住,任何技术手段的实施都应以合法合规为前提,持续优化策略以适应不断变化的环境。

用户体验安全性第三方服务集成域名白名单微信开放平台链接访问权限微信拦截域名开发者策略
朗读
赞(0)
版权属于:

至尊技术网

本文链接:

https://www.zzwws.cn/archives/13113/(转载时请注明本文出处及文章链接)

评论 (0)